油水分配系数/LogP:

LogP值指的是某物质在正辛醇/水两相体系中的分配系数的对数值,反映了物质在油水两相中的分配情况。其中、LogP值越大,说明该物质越亲油;反之,LogP值越小,则说明该物质越亲水。

SECTION 9: Physical and Chemical Properties
   Color and Form:       orange-brown solid    
   Molecular Weight:       888.46    
   Melting Point:       no data    
   Boiling Point:       no data    
   Vapor Pressure:       no data    
   Specific Gravity:       no data    
   Odor:       none    
   Solubility in Water:       insoluble    

SECTION 10: Stability and Reactivity
   Stability:       air and moisture stable    
   Hazardous Polymerization:       no hazardous polymerization    
   Conditions to Avoid:       none    
   Incompatibility:       oxidizing agents, halogens and active metals    
   Decomposition Products:       carbon monoxide, carbon dioxide, organic fumes, ruthenium oxide
